在数字化时代,拥有一个功能齐全、稳定可靠的网站对于企业和个人来说至关重要。阿里云作为中国领先的云计算服务提供商,提供了强大的基础设施和丰富的工具,帮助用户轻松搭建和管理网站。本文将详细介绍如何利用阿里云搭建一个完整的网站,从域名注册到服务器配置,再到网站部署,一步步带你完成整个过程。
1. 注册阿里云账号并购买域名
你需要注册一个阿里云账号。访问阿里云官网(https://www.aliyun.com),点击“免费注册”并按照提示完成账号注册。注册完成后,登录阿里云控制台。
你需要为你的网站购买一个域名。在阿里云控制台中,找到“域名与网站”选项,点击“域名注册”。输入你想要的域名,系统会检查该域名是否可用。如果可用,选择注册年限并完成支付。域名注册成功后,你将拥有一个独一无二的网站地址。
2. 购买云服务器(ECS)
域名注册完成后,你需要购买一台云服务器(ECS)来托管你的网站。在阿里云控制台中,找到“云服务器ECS”选项,点击“立即购买”。根据你的需求选择合适的配置,包括CPU、内存、存储空间和带宽等。阿里云提供了多种操作系统选项,如Windows和Linux,你可以根据网站的技术需求选择合适的系统。
购买完成后,你将获得一个公网IP地址,这是用户访问你网站的入口。确保在购买时选择合适的地域和可用区,以保证网站的访问速度和稳定性。
3. 配置服务器环境
服务器购买完成后,你需要配置服务器环境以支持网站的运行。如果你选择的是Linux系统,可以通过SSH连接到服务器,并安装必要的软件,如Apache或Nginx作为Web服务器,MySQL或PostgreSQL作为数据库,以及PHP或Python等编程语言环境。
阿里云提供了丰富的文档和教程,帮助你快速完成服务器环境的配置。你还可以使用阿里云的“云市场”购买预配置的服务器镜像,这些镜像已经包含了常用的Web服务器和数据库软件,大大简化了配置过程。
4. 部署网站代码
服务器环境配置完成后,你可以将网站代码上传到服务器。如果你使用的是FTP工具,可以通过FTP客户端将代码上传到服务器的指定目录。如果你使用的是Git,可以通过Git命令将代码从远程仓库克隆到服务器。
上传完成后,配置Web服务器以指向你的网站根目录。例如,在Nginx中,你可以编辑配置文件,将根目录指向你上传的网站代码所在的路径。确保配置文件正确无误后,重启Web服务器以使配置生效。
5. 域名解析与SSL证书配置
为了让用户通过域名访问你的网站,你需要将域名解析到服务器的公网IP地址。在阿里云控制台中,找到“域名解析”选项,添加一条A记录,将域名指向服务器的IP地址。解析生效后,用户就可以通过域名访问你的网站了。
为了提升网站的安全性,建议为你的网站配置SSL证书,启用HTTPS协议。阿里云提供了免费的SSL证书服务,你可以在控制台中申请并配置SSL证书。配置完成后,你的网站将支持HTTPS访问,数据传输将更加安全。
6. 网站测试与优化
网站部署完成后,进行全面的测试,确保所有功能正常运行。你可以使用浏览器访问网站,检查页面加载速度、链接是否正常、表单提交是否成功等。如果发现问题,及时进行调整和修复。
为了提高网站的性能和用户体验,你可以使用阿里云的CDN(内容分发网络)服务,加速静态资源的加载速度。此外,定期备份网站数据,防止数据丢失。阿里云提供了自动备份功能,你可以设置备份策略,确保数据安全。
7. 网站维护与监控
网站上线后,定期进行维护和监控是必不可少的。阿里云提供了丰富的监控工具,如云监控、日志服务等,帮助你实时了解服务器的运行状态和网站的性能表现。通过监控数据,你可以及时发现并解决潜在问题,确保网站的稳定运行。
定期更新网站内容和软件版本,修复安全漏洞,提升用户体验。阿里云的安全中心提供了全面的安全防护服务,帮助你抵御各种网络攻击,保障网站的安全。
结语
通过以上步骤,你可以利用阿里云轻松搭建一个功能齐全、安全可靠的网站。无论是个人博客、企业官网还是电子商务平台,阿里云都能为你提供强大的技术支持和服务保障。希望本文的指南能够帮助你顺利完成网站搭建,开启你的在线之旅。